An overview of clinical activities in Endo-ERN: the need for alignment of future network criteria.

Friso de VriesMees BruinAngelica CersosimoCharlotte N van BeuzekomSyed Faisal AhmedRobin P PeetersNienke R BiermaszOlaf HiortAlberto M Pereira
Published in: European journal of endocrinology (2020)
Monitoring of clinical activity in an ERN requires clear definitions that are optimally aligned with clinical practice, diagnosis registration, and hospital IT systems. This is a particular challenge in the rare disease field where the centre may also provide expert input in collaboration with local hospitals. Application of uniform definitions, in addition to condition-specific clinical benchmarks, which can include patient-reported- as well as clinician-reported outcome measures, is urgently needed to allow benchmarking of care across Endo-ERN.
